Is there any way to switch out the brake pedal rods on 2 identical power boosters?

If the rods going into the booster are the same diameter you should be able to switch them.
Some rods have a stepped end so you have to remove the rear booster seal with the rod and then take out the rod. Others the rods will just slip out the seal. Just pull on the rod and if it comes out easily the great. If not, take the rod out with the seal. Ensure the ends of both rods have the same profile before switching also. They mate to a matching surface.

Yeah, some just fall out. Bought a booster for my brother a few years back - picked it up off the table, rod just fell out. Luckily I saw it happen and wasn't walking away through the grass with it. Then I have another, also supposed to be from a Javelin - the rod stays in it nicely but if you do remove it, that rear seal comes out with it.
So - it's a matter of matching things up - if you have two that match, great, but how to remove seems to rely on the specific booster. Odd both of these I have are from Javelin and yet the rods come out differently. I have never bothered paying attention to them otherwise, didn't care - they aren't for me. |
